Steenbergen Settlers in United States in the 18th Century
- Hans Jacob Steenbergen, who landed in New York in 1709 2
Steenbergen Settlers in United States in the 19th Century
- Adriana Van Steenbergen, who landed in Iowa in 1854 2
- Mrs. C Van Steenbergen, who arrived in Iowa in 1854 2
- Cornelis Van Steenbergen, who landed in Iowa in 1854 2
- Dirkje Van Steenbergen, who arrived in Iowa in 1854 2
- Krijn Van Steenbergen, who arrived in Iowa in 1854 2

| Contemporary Notables of the name Steenbergen (post 1700) | + |
- Marrit Steenbergen, Dutch two-times gold and eight-times silver medalist competitive swimmer
- Piet Steenbergen (1928-2010), Dutch football midfielder
- Quinta Steenbergen (b. 1985), Dutch silver medalist volleyball player, member of the Women's National Team
- Dylan Steenbergen (b. 1987), former professional Canadian CFL football offensive lineman who played from 2009 to 2012
- Rik Van Steenbergen (1924-2003), Belgian racing cyclist
